Sandy Huang 2f8fbe0ac7 arm64: dts: rockchip: Fixes warning in unit address of drm-logo
/reserved-memory/drm-logo@00000000 refers to a node in the device tree.
The part after the @ symbol is the unit address, which should match the
physical or logical address of the device or memory region being
described.

The warning indicates that the unit name (in this case, 00000000) should
not have leading zeros. This is more about adhering to conventions and
ensuring compatibility and readability than about functional
correctness.
